Gamarochttps://www.blogger.com/profile/12094949023500912672no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-8611810694571930415.post-12068483929290126642016-05-17T13:01:28.683-04:002016-05-17T13:01:28.683-04:00Results of the new NAEP test of technology and eng...Results of the new NAEP test of technology and engineering skills in eighth graders show that girls do slightly better than boys. Other results:<br /><br />"More affluent students performed substantially better than their poorer counterparts, with only 25 percent of lower-income students scoring at or above the proficient level, compared to 59 percent of wealthier students. Only 18 percent of black students and 28 percent of Hispanic students achieved proficient scores or higher, compared to 56 percent of Asian-American and white students."<br /><br />Some studies have shown that verbal ability is needed for math performance but not vice versa. It seems likely that literacy skills are important to technology and engineering performance, given that (1) girls tend to have higher verbal ability than boys, and (2) literacy skills may contribute to test taking proficiency in general, and (3) literacy skills may be crucial for classroom learning no matter what the subject matter.<br /><br />I think it would be a good idea for Somerby to explain what he means by literacy skills.Anonymousnore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-8611810694571930415.post-20281245566190331292016-05-17T11:08:28.132-04:002016-05-17T11:08:28.132-04:00Just as the press has failed to push back against ...Just as the press has failed to push back against specious accusations aimed at the Clintons, it has failed to vet Bernie Sanders.
